(1H-Imidazo[4,5-c]pyridin-2-yl)-1,2,5-oxadiazol-3-ylamine derivatives: Further optimisation as highly potent and selective MSK-1-inhibitors
Bamford, Mark J.,Bailey, Nicholas,Davies, Susannah,Dean, David K.,Francis, Leann,Panchal, Terence A.,Parr, Christopher A.,Sehmi, Sanjeet,Steadman, Jon G.,Takle, Andrew K.,Townsend, James T.,Wilson, David M.
, p. 3407 - 3411 (2007/10/03)
The novel imidazo[4,5-c]pyridine 1,2,5-oxadiazol-3-yl template affords an excellent start point for identification of inhibitors of a number of protein kinases. Here we report on its optimisation for mitogen and stress-activated protein kinase-1 (MSK-1) inhibitory activity, and selectivity over other kinases.
CANCER TREATMENT METHOD
-
Page/Page column 78; 85, (2010/02/11)
The present invention relates to a method of treating cancer in a mammal and to pharmaceutical combinations useful in such treatment. In particular, the method relates to a cancer treatment method that includes administering an erb family inhibitor and a PI3K and/or Akt inhibitor to a mammal suffering from a cancer.
